Output 236c86107c21f63bec866e15363576121acc2cb3b09de46e7991b7a1d02dfb46:1

value
297058162
script pubkey
OP_0 OP_PUSHBYTES_20 8e44b29388bf8cee2b4cbf1b04abd3a902404a2c
address
bc1q3ezt9yugh7xwu26vhudsf27n4ypyqj3vvdd4c4
transaction
236c86107c21f63bec866e15363576121acc2cb3b09de46e7991b7a1d02dfb46
spent
true